Works well, comes with a screw to hold the keychain together. I would buy again.

I use this cover on a 2011 Kia Soul+. For those wondering, tiny screws are included in the package to hold the keychain together. Some cheaper versions don't have this screw and will fall apart over time. It was easy to take my old key fob part and replace the electronic part. If I were smarter, I could take the supplied blank and copy my old one to the new one. But since I'm pretty cheap I didn't do that. I used a hole punch kit to remove the pin holding the blank to the new piece of metal and my old key to the old piece of metal, then inserted the old key into the new piece of metal. I would just swap out the entire assembly for a new plastic case, but when I've done that in the past it hasn't quite fitted, so I didn't want to risk not fitting. After swapping the pins, the rest of the build process was very easy and the remote control works great.
